How to get there

Plane

The best way to get to Potsdam by plane is to fly to Berlin Tegel Airport, which is about 30 km away or Berlin Schönefeld Airport, which is about 40 km away. From there, take a train or bus to Potsdam.

Car

The best way to get to Potsdam by car is to take the A115 motorway from Berlin to Potsdam, which takes about 30 minutes depending on traffic.

Train

The best way to get to Potsdam by train is to take a regional train from Berlin Hauptbahnhof or Berlin Zoologischer Garten to Potsdam Hauptbahnhof, which takes about 30 minutes.

Boat

The best way to get to Potsdam by boat is to take a scenic boat tour from Berlin to Potsdam along the River Havel, which takes about 4 hours.

Bus

The best way to get to Potsdam by bus is to take bus 316 or 643 from Berlin ZOB bus station to Potsdam, which takes about 40 minutes.
